After several years as my name inched up Harry’s waitlist I finally sent my IIa to him so he could work on it. When he received the box one side of it was smashed open and was empty, no camera. He relentlessly pursued the problem with the post office until they found the camera unharmed (I had wrapped it in lots of bubble wrap) and as everyone else has said his work was outstanding and I received back a camera that was not only as good as as new but I believe probably better.

Hello, yes, I shot this photo with the wonderful Biogon 21/4.5 serviced by your uncle. I purchased the lens from a RFF member a few years ago and it came with some notes from Mr. Scherer and a service invoice. He overhauled the lens, machined the RF coupling to remove interference, and provided a rear cap.
